Economic and Labour Market Paper 2008/1. Labour in India refers to employment in the economy of India.In 2012, there were around 487 million workers in India, the second largest after China. Of these over 94 percent work in unincorporated, unorganised enterprises ranging from pushcart vendors to home-based diamond and gem polishing operations. The long run trend in India has been towards the institutional labour^ market where the influence of demand and supply is considerably curtailed by policies of unions, employers and the government. The most notable pieces of legislation which aim to strengthen the labour market include: 1. the Labour Relations Act (LRA); 2. the Basic Conditions of Employment Act (BCEA); 3. the Employment Equity Act (EEA); 4. and the Skills Development Act (SDA). A simple definition of the labour market is given by Derek Bosworth, Peter Dawkins and Thorsten Stromback (1996) who state that the labour market is the place where supply and demand meet, working to determine the price and quantity of the work performed.
